摘要
Context. Pain in oncology patients often leads to a specific movement behavior and has obvious effects on participation in the social system (compare international classification of functioning, disability and health, ICF). Discussion. The physiotherapeutic process (i.e. assessment, defining goals, planning therapy and defining active and passive interventions) supports patients throughout the whole course of an oncological disease from the early phase through to the palliative phase with the main goal to improve the quality of life. Physiotherapists as experts for movement and movement behavior are important members in the interdisciplinary team and can deliver important information regarding the effect of pain in a patient's daily functional life to improve the overall therapy strategy. © 2014 Springer-Verlag.
